Linda Lerner is a Partner in the Corporate, Financial Services and White Collar & Regulatory Enforcement groups of Crowell & Moring LLP. She has extensive experience with regulatory and compliance issues relating to broker-dealer registration and compliance, municipal advisor registration, public and private securities sales, market making, and market structure issues.

Prior to joining Crowell in 2011, Ms. Lerner spent seven years at Debevoise & Plimpton as broker-dealer regulatory counsel. Ms. Lerner also served for 12 years as General Counsel at Domestic Securities, Inc., a registered broker-dealer, where she focused on a wide range of broker-dealer regulatory and compliance issues. During this time, she served on several NASD and Nasdaq committees, including the Membership Application Review Committee, the Market Operations Review Committee and the Trading Rules Subcommittee of the Quality of Markets Committee, and was a frequent lecturer on regulatory and market structure matters. Before joining Domestic Securities, she spent 15 years in private practice, working as an associate and a partner at New York law firms.

She received her J.D., magna cum laude, from Brooklyn Law School, an M.S. in Social Work from Columbia University and her B.A. from Brandeis University.

Ms. Lerner is a co-author of Bloomberg BNA Securities Practice Portfolio Series No. 381, Broker-Dealer Registration: Demystifying the Process.
